From: Simon Glass Date: Wed, 11 Nov 2015 17:05:39 +0000 (-0700) Subject: input: Handle caps lock X-Git-Tag: v2016.01-rc2~219 X-Git-Url: http://review.tizen.org/git/?a=commitdiff_plain;h=ba42034267050d1a41479ba133d1c5b8679397f7;p=platform%2Fkernel%2Fu-boot.git input: Handle caps lock When caps lock is enabled we should convert lower case to upper case. Add this to the input key processing so that caps lock works correctly.
